Output 75c495923e10edb6877c787e4520d8530af17a39ba9668bf808687af89f30a44:0

value
3079208
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6bbfbaaab3c212fdec1c468c4897c71a24704a3b OP_EQUALVERIFY OP_CHECKSIG
address
1Apiz6uuqKYFngL4jcBexxiq6JXLKmh7yc
transaction
75c495923e10edb6877c787e4520d8530af17a39ba9668bf808687af89f30a44
spent
true